Phoenix Children’s Chorus is seeking new members. Boys and girls currently in first through eleventh grades who love to sing are encouraged to attend a free audition, 5:30 p.m. Tuesday, June 17 at the Phoenix Center for the Arts, 1202 N. 3rd St. A sign on the front door will give the room where the auditions take place in the building.

The child will go before the music directors, who will ask the child to match pitch by playing a few notes on the piano for the child to repeat acappella (without accompaniment). Each child is taught a new song that they sing for their audition. Then if the child can read music they will be given the opportunity to demonstrate that ability.

PCC is looking for children who have a clear and pleasant singing voice, love to sing and can match pitch. PCC is a choral music education organization.
